On Di, 21 Mai 2013, Christian Brabandt wrote: > And also not supported yet are \_[...] > collections.
BTW: This patch enables the \_[...] collections. diff --git a/src/regexp_nfa.c b/src/regexp_nfa.c --- a/src/regexp_nfa.c +++ b/src/regexp_nfa.c @@ -679,9 +679,7 @@ /* "\_[" is collection plus newline */ if (c == '[') - /* TODO: make this work - * goto collection; */ - return FAIL; + goto collection; /* "\_x" is character class plus newline */ /*FALLTHROUGH*/ @@ -891,7 +889,7 @@ } break; -/* collection: */ +collection: case Magic('['): /* * Glue is emitted between several atoms from the []. regards, Christian -- Skepsis ist das Zeichen - und sogar die Pose - des gebildeten Verstandes. -- John Dewey -- -- You received this message from the "vim_dev" maillist.
